mmm just see if you can take it for good ride(like a good hour or more.) Cause mine flat rips but the 07 Does have some issues. I just got back in from another ride and i think it might have a bad rave valve or some crap in the carbs. Mine has 700miles also and have herd from some guys that this is about the time the rave valves need to be cleaned or if broken, replaced. Other than that i like mine. Never had any major issues with and like i said they come with some extras that the X packages didnt(TI springs, Clicker shocks, 15lbs lighter{i think}than X, etc.)

IMHO stay far away! I had the XRS and it was not reliable at all. Dealer replaced the rave valves, replaced every component in the clutch, then the clutch itself, engine light was comming on dealer couldn't find problem the list goes on. O'ya not to mention the crank problems!
